Lista de documentos de ECM
La vista de coach Lista de documentos de ECM muestra (en formato tabular) archivos y documentos de una carpeta en un almacén de ECM configurable. Los sucesos se pueden activar a partir de acciones de usuario de la lista, como por ejemplo pulsar en un archivo para ver su contenido. Los archivos también se pueden suprimir de la lista, si se ha permitido en la configuración.
Integración con un servidor de Enterprise Content Management
Suponiendo que los usuarios tengan los permisos adecuados pueden añadir nuevos documentos. Desde la columna de acciones, los usuarios pueden seleccionar una acción para realizar en un documento. Puede establecer opciones de configuración para que los usuarios puedan actualizar un documento existente, ver las versiones del documento y suprimir el documento.| Acción | Descripción |
|---|---|
| Actualizar | Sustituye el contenido del archivo y actualiza sus propiedades. |
| Mostrar versiones de documento | Muestra las versiones del documento. |
| Suprimir | Elimina el documento. |
Para integrar la vista de coach Lista de documentos de ECM con un servidor ECM (Enterprise Content Management), la aplicación de proceso debe tener una conexión con dicho servidor. Consulte Añadir un servidor de Enterprise Content Management. Para obtener información sobre cómo crear servicios ECM, consulte Creación de un servicio que se integra con un sistema ECM o un almacén de IBM BPM. Para obtener información adicional, consulte los temas en Habilitación del soporte de documentos.
Restricciones y limitaciones
Ninguno
Enlace de datos
Establecer el enlace de datos para el control en la pestaña de propiedades General.| Descripción de enlace | Tipo de datos |
|---|---|
| El enlace ECMDocumentInfo contiene el URL para el documento seleccionado. | ECMDocumentInfo |
Propiedades de configuración
Puede definir o modificar las propiedades de configuración del control, como por ejemplo las propiedades de comportamiento y aspecto, en la pestaña de propiedades de Configuración.- Tamaño de pantalla
- Una
propiedad de configuración que tenga el icono Tamaños de pantalla
además del nombre de
propiedad, puede tener distintos valores para cada tamaño de
pantalla. Si no define un valor, el tamaño de la pantalla hereda el valor del siguiente tamaño de pantalla más grande como su valor predeterminado. Si está utilizando el editor de escritorio de Process Designer (en desuso), está estableciendo el valor para el tamaño de pantalla grande. Los otros tamaños de pantalla heredan este valor.
En la tabla siguiente se muestran las propiedades de configuración de la gestión de contenidos para el control Lista de documentos de ECM:
| Propiedad de gestión de contenido | Descripción | Tipo de datos |
|---|---|---|
| Permitir crear | Permitir que los usuarios añadan un documento al repositorio de documentos de Enterprise Content Management. El valor predeterminado es false. | Boolean |
| Permitir actualizaciones | Indicador booleano de si los archivos de la lista se pueden actualizar. | Boolean |
| Permitir supresiones de documentos | Si esta opción está inhabilitada, no se pueden suprimir archivos utilizando este control. | Boolean |
| Confirmar al suprimir | Mostrar un diálogo de confirmación antes de suprimir archivos. | Boolean |
| Permitir visualización de revisiones | Indicador booleano de si los archivos de la lista muestran sus versiones. | Boolean |
| Máximo de resultados | El número máximo de archivos a mostrar. | Integer |
| Filtro | Propiedades con las que filtrar archivos. Estas propiedades se asignan durante la carga (si se han asignado). | NameValuePair[] |
| Filtro de consulta CMIS | Serie de texto que contiene la consulta de CMIS (Content Management Interoperability Services). | String |
| Servicio de búsqueda | El servicio para utilizar cuando se buscan documentos. | Servicio de búsqueda de Documentos de ECM |
Las propiedades de configuración avanzadas de gestión de contenidos para el control Lista de documentos de ECM se muestran en la tabla siguiente:
| Propiedad avanzada de gestión de contenidos | Descripción | Tipo de datos |
|---|---|---|
| Nombre de configuración de servidor ECM | El servidor ECM a utilizar. El servidor predeterminado es el servidor ECM incorporado. | String |
| ID de tipo de objeto de documento | Especifique el documentObjectType de los documentos. Esto se debe definir en el servidor ECM. | String |
| Vía de acceso a carpeta | La vía de acceso a carpeta predeterminada es la carpeta raíz. | String |
En la tabla siguiente se muestran las propiedades de configuración del comportamiento para el control Lista de documentos de ECM:
| Propiedad de configuración del comportamiento | Descripción | Tipo de datos |
|---|---|---|
| Mostrar pie de página | Mostrar el pie de página. | Boolean |
| Mostrar estadísticas de tabla | Mostrar estadísticas de tabla, por ejemplo, "Mostrando de 1 a 5 de 59 entradas". | Boolean |
| Tamaño máximo de archivo (MB) | El tamaño máximo de archivo (en megabytes) para las cargas. | Decimal |
| Mostrar paginador | Mostrar el paginador. | Boolean |
| Tamaño de página inicial | Número máximo inicial de entradas que se deben mostrar por página. | Integer |
| Propiedades predeterminadas de documento | Seleccione la variable a utilizar para las propiedades predeterminadas del documento de ECM. Cuando se crea un documento de ECM, la lista de documentos contiene los valores predeterminados para las propiedades del documento. Los valores podrían ser de sólo lectura u ocultos a los usuarios cuando crean el documento. | Lista de ECMDefaultProperty |
| Tipos de archivos permitidos | Seleccione un tipo de archivo o especifique el valor predeterminado para especificar su propio tipo de archivo. Si está vacío, todos los tipos de archivo son válidos. | FileType[] |
En la tabla siguiente se muestran las propiedades de configuración del aspecto para el control Lista de documentos de ECM:
| Propiedad de configuración del aspecto | Descripción | Tipo de datos |
|---|---|---|
| Estilo de tabla | El estilo de tabla de este control. | String |
| Estilo de color | El estilo de color de este control. | String |
| Columnas | Las columnas a visualizar en la lista. | FileListColumn[] |
Sucesos
.Establezca o modifique los manejadores de sucesos para el control en la pestaña Sucesos. Puede definir que los sucesos se desencadenen mediante programación o cuando el usuario interactúa con el control. Para obtener información sobre cómo definir y codificar sucesos, consulte Sucesos definidos por el usuario. El control Lista de documentos de ECM tiene los siguientes tipos de manejadores de sucesos:- En archivo pulsado: Se activa cuando se pulsa en un archivo. Por ejemplo:
console.log(doc.fileName) - En error: Se activa cuando hay un error al ejecutar operaciones en la lista de documentos. Por ejemplo:
alert("There has been an error: "+message)
Según el suceso específico, puede utilizar lógica de JavaScript para modificar los efectos del control. Puede obtener más información sobre la utilización de sucesos con controles en el tema Sucesos definidos por el usuario.
Métodos
Si desea información detallada sobre los métodos disponibles para Lista de documentos de ECM, consulte la API JavaScript Lista de documentos de ECM.
Recursos adicionales
Para obtener información sobre cómo crear un coach, consulte Creación de coaches.
Para obtener información sobre las propiedades estándar (General, Configuración, Posicionamiento, Visibilidad y Atributos HTML), consulte Propiedades de vista de coach.
Para obtener información sobre otros controles de IU de BPM y de gestión de contenidos, consulte Kit de herramientas de IU de BPM and Kit de herramientas de la gestión de contenidos.